Hey,
What are the difference between Red and Yellow Top....

Deep cycle (yellow top) is designed to be discharged repeatedly with no damage to the battery. They will be heavier due to the increased size of the lead used in the plates.
A deep cycle battery is designed for vehicles with a lot of accessories that will cause drain such as winches, large stereos, tons of off-road lighting, etc. Deep cycle batteries the same size as a regular battery do not have as high of CCA. Therefore, it is suggested to go to a larger deep cycle battery.
The yellow top Optima D75/25 has 650 CCA, while the 75/25 red top has 720 CCA. If you are in a cold climate, the CCA can be important. In addition, cranking amps at 32 degrees F is 100 amps more for the red top versus the yellow top.
